The Division of Laboratory Medicine of the Marshfield Clinic Health System is seeking an enthusiastic and team oriented full time board-certified Anatomic and/or Clinical Pathologist to join our practice. The successful applicant will become a member of the newly created Regional Division of Marshfield Lab and Pathology Service. The primary responsibilities include serving as CLIA laboratory medical director to several outlying hospitals and clinics across the growing Marshfield Health Care System in Wisconsin. These same CLIA-related responsibilities will extend to outlying hospitals and clinics currently being serviced by Marshfield Pathology but not a formal member of the Marshfield system. Additional responsibilities will include occasional surgical pathology sign out of Marshfield system specimens.
You will be joining a laboratory team that includes nearly 20 pathologists located in four communities in central and northern Wisconsin. Our pathology specialists have expertise in cytopathology, dermatopathology, gastrointestinal pathology, hematopathology, infectious disease pathology, molecular pathology, nephropathology, neuropathology/ neuromuscular pathology, pulmonary pathology, and transfusion medicine, and are supported by 5 PhD clinical laboratory scientists.
The Pathology Department accessions approximately 43,000 surgical cases each year and maintains on-site ancillary diagnostic services including a broad immunohistochemical menu, transmission electron microscopy, cytogenetics and a molecular pathology laboratory. Academic affiliations with regional universities and research opportunities in collaboration with the Marshfield Clinic Research Institute are encouraged.

Job Qualifications:
EDUCATION
Minimum Required: MD or DO degree from accredited medical school with certification by the American Board of Pathology in Anatomic and Clinical Pathology or Clinical Pathology.
EXPERIENCE
Minimum Required: Demonstrated knowledge and experience in laboratory medicine. Demonstrated ability to work and communicate effectively with diverse physicians and medical staff groups. Prior experience providing medical directorship to a CLIA certified clinical laboratory.
Preferred/Optional: Three years' experience as practicing pathologist with prior laboratory directorship experience.
CERTIFICATIONS/LICENSES
The following licensure(s), certification(s), registration(s), etc., are required for this position. Licenses with restrictions are subject to review to determine if restrictions are substantially related to the position.
Minimum Required: Board certified in Anatomic and Clinical Pathology or Clinical Pathology. License to practice medicine in the State of Wisconsin
